logo

Output 40694374fabe3ae309fb195ec6dbfd4874dede5fbd912ed175416f692c27bb07:8

value
58528080
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0632951fda755e44e56a5fef6c36876a16ec5ba OP_EQUALVERIFY OP_CHECKSIG
address
1MTT9psb4AbZSRdjRkCgEPk5b4T5BJfa1e
transaction
40694374fabe3ae309fb195ec6dbfd4874dede5fbd912ed175416f692c27bb07